Guildhall School Professor Dr Toby Young awarded prestigious Future Leaders Fellowship Guildhall School is delighted to announce that Dr Toby Young is to receive a Future Leaders Fellowship, awarded by UKRI (UK Research & Innovation). The fellowship provides a grant of £1.4 million, to fund Dr Young’s research project Immersive Opera.
